Default Knock sensor code help.

I have a code about the knock sensor P0332 to be exact. Can someone enlighten me on how to fix it? Honestly I have no clue where to look for this.

There's two knock sensors, both are located under the intake - you're throwing the code for the rear one. You can look up the code description/diagnosis for your year at gearchatter.com ls1howto.com has an intake removal guide, if you need to replace it I'd do both sensors while the intake is off.
